ECONOMIC, SOCIAL AND INDUSTRIAL RELEVANCE

Industrial plastic, foam rubber and coatings have relevance across sectors. Their economic, social and industrial importance are intertwined.

Foam rubbers are used in cushioning automobile seats, furniture insulation in walls, and applied in soles and heels in footwear as well as in insulating buildings, refrigerators and freezers (City-Data, 2021). Plastics are used in packaging, food conservation and preservation, provision of convenience, safety and hygiene. They are used for building and construction, plastic pipes, windows, insulation, transportation, for saving energy and reducing greenhouse gas emissions and many more (Millet, Vangheluwe, Block, Sevenster, Gracia, Anotonopoulos, 2018).

Industrial coatings provide protection and safety, prevent corrosion, and keep surfaces clean. (Toefco, 2012).

RAW MATERIALS, PRODUCTS AND BY-PRODUCTS

Production of plastics cuts across thermoplastics, polyurethanes, thermosets, adhesives, coatings, sealants and PP-fibres. Also, the top three markets for the use of plastic include packing, building and construction and the automotive sector.

Different foam rubbers include polyether, polyester, ethafoam, volara, closed-Cell Sponge rubber, open-cell Sponge rubber, Cellulose and scrubber foams.

They are used to produce sponges, general cushioning, protective packaging, paint rollers, gaskets, acoustic purposes, packaging electronic equipment, floatation applications, material handling, tapes, medical products, insulation, protective padding, electrical outlets, weather-stripping, thermal insulation, industrial padding, shoe soles, repetitive wear and tear, non-woven fibre scrubber and many more (Thomas Insight, 2021). The process of coating is used in almost every item produced in any industry. They protect a diverse array of products from corrosion, wear and tear. Coating also brings in an aesthetic and colourful appearance.
